24 Hour Nurse – A Mother’s Day Story

24 Hour Nurse: A Mother’s Day Story

It’s a beautiful thing that International Nurses Day coincides with Mother’s Day this year, Nicky Hondros, a palliative care nurse shares her and her mums heart felt story and provides a little glimpse into what it’s like caring for someone living with dementia.

Essential worker’s permits – who needs one?

Under the Victorian government’s new Permitted Worker Scheme, essential workers and on site staff will now be required to carry a worker’s permit from 11:59pm tonight. The paper permit is designed to streamline the process of police stops and checks for staff heading into work. Read More
